Bishal Rai


Bishal Rai is a Nepalese footballer, who currently plays for Manang Marshyangdi Club and the Nepal national football team.

Career

Bishal Rai started off in the ANFA Jhapa Youth Academy before joining Machhindra F.C. in 2008. He played for Machindra for four years straight with the exception of a loan move to Saraswoti Youth Club two years after arriving. Later in 2014 he joined Manang Marshyangdi Club ahead of the 2013–14 Martyr's Memorial A-Division League season.

International career

Rai played for Nepal at the u-14, u-16 and u-19 youth levels. After being routinely called up for the senior squad since 2014 Rai finally made his senior national team debut on 31 August 2015 in a friendly against India. Bishal Rai scored a goal for in a 4-1 win against Maldives in the Bangabandhu gold cup on 19 January 2016.
